The Forged Clamping Ring is a high-strength structural component designed to ensure even load distribution in clamping systems for industrial machines. It secures key components under high axial or radial pressure, maintaining operational stability and precise alignment over long-term use. Manufactured as a heavy-duty forged ring, it outperforms cast or fabricated alternatives in fatigue resistance, structural integrity, and durability.
Typical Applications
Injection molding machines – clamping and securing components
Feed extrusion machines – high-load screw and barrel assemblies
Industrial presses requiring uniform clamping force
Other machinery where high-strength forged components are needed for clamping or load transfer
Typical Dimensions & Weight
Outer Diameter: 400–1000 mm
Wall Thickness: 50–150 mm
Weight: 200 kg–2 t
